As a guard of 27 years service, and the last 12 years as the staff rep and HSWA Rep. I did the rosters we worked.
As there were 7 men in the roster, that gave us a 49 day link.
We worked a maximum continous shifts of 6 days, which is half what Hidden reccomends.
The link consisted of 49 days of which 21 days were rest days, from this link we averaged 35hrs, which is what we were paid.
On week 4 of the link we had 7 days off from duty.
Week 7 was to cover for annual leave.
Working round this link was great as all our jobs were early mornings with a shift length of between 6hrs and 12 hrs.(12 hours for Ballast Turns.)
All shifts had over 14 hours rest between turns of duty, better than Hidden(12)
